Hebrew · H5518

סִיר

A pot ; also a thorn (as springing up rapidly); by implication, a hook

How does the BSB render H5518?

The BSB source-word alignment has 34 aligned rows for this entry. Common renderings include the pots (5), pot (3), the pot (3), in the pot (2), is My washbasin (2).

Where does סִיר (siyr) appear in Scripture?

The source-word alignment first shows this entry at Exodus 16:3. Its strongest book concentrations include 2 Kings (6), Ezekiel (5), 2 Chronicles (3), Exodus (3).
